A definition/description of the source (one –two sentences)
Industrial effluent is water that flows from man-made structures, typically pipes, in industrial areas. As a result of this, it tends to be rather polluted and is mostly just the waste-water discharge from industrial plants.
The actual pollutants associated with the source (list)
Mercury
Lead
Ammonia
Cyanide
Radioactive waste
Zinc
Arsenic
Pol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bons
